Logo Wand.Tools

Генератор SQL WHERE

Используйте ИИ для генерации операторов WHERE для фильтрации данных в SQL-запросах

Руководство по SQL WHERE Clause

Руководство по SQL WHERE Clause

SQL WHERE Clause используется для фильтрации записей, которые соответствуют определенным условиям. Это важная часть SQL-запросов, позволяющая извлекать только те данные, которые вам нужны.

Синтаксис

Основной синтаксис WHERE Clause выглядит следующим образом:

SELECT column1, column2, ...
FROM table_name
WHERE condition;

Примеры

Пример 1: Простое условие

SELECT * FROM Customers
WHERE Country = 'USA';

Этот запрос извлекает всех клиентов из США.

Пример 2: Использование оператора AND

SELECT * FROM Customers
WHERE Country = 'USA' AND City = 'New York';

Этот запрос извлекает клиентов, которые из США и живут в Нью-Йорке.

Пример 3: Использование оператора OR

SELECT * FROM Customers
WHERE Country = 'USA' OR Country = 'Canada';

Этот запрос извлекает клиентов, которые либо из США, либо из Канады.

Пример 4: Использование оператора NOT

SELECT * FROM Customers
WHERE NOT Country = 'USA';

Этот запрос извлекает клиентов, которые не из США.

Пример 5: Использование оператора IN

SELECT * FROM Customers
WHERE Country IN ('USA', 'Canada', 'Mexico');

Этот запрос извлекает клиентов из США, Канады или Мексики.

Пример 6: Использование оператора BETWEEN

SELECT * FROM Products
WHERE Price BETWEEN 10 AND 20;

Этот запрос извлекает продукты с ценой от 10 до 20.

Пример 7: Использование оператора LIKE

SELECT * FROM Customers
WHERE CustomerName LIKE 'A%';

Этот запрос извлекает клиентов, чьи имена начинаются с ‘A’.

Заключение

WHERE Clause — это мощный инструмент в SQL, который позволяет фильтровать данные на основе определенных условий. Освоив WHERE Clause, вы сможете писать более эффективные и точные запросы.

Для более сложной фильтрации вы можете комбинировать WHERE Clause с другими SQL-предложениями, такими как GROUP BY, HAVING и ORDER BY.